This morning, around seven o’clock, a traffic accident occurred in To-yoko line (one of the busiest line in Japan) by which I commute everyday.

Due to the accident, about half of the railroad was shut down but fortunately, trains went back and forth between Sibuya station and Musashi Kosugi station which is exactly my commuting section.

I moved to Musashi Kosugi about one year ago and since then I sometimes feel it is really convenient for me to go anywhere from here Musashi Kosugi by train and this is the reason why I bought my house here.

In Tokyo, I think it is very important element for business people to prevent from too much exhaustion while commuting. In terms of that I am lucky to live here.

This town is growing bigger and bigger at this moment. However, I think various kinds of living environments, including schools, libraries and shopping centers should be more developed by the municiple government.

Anyway, I look forward to seeing how this town will be grown up in the future.
